SOUTHWEST SHEPHERD’S PIE IN A FLASH
Serves 4
Ingredients
- 1 package any good brand of mashed potato flakes, garlic or butter flavored
- 1 TBSP olive oil
- 1 lb. ground beef
- 1 medium onion diced
- 2 tsp. chili powder or red pepper
- ¾ tsp. salt
- 1 16-oz. can diced tomatoes, with chilies if you like
- 1 16-oz. can Baked Beans or Black beans
- 1 11-oz. can whole kernel corn, well drained
- ½ Cup shredded Cheddar cheese
- ¼ Cup chopped fresh cilantro
Instructions
- Heat oil in a skillet over medium-high heat.
- Add ground beef and onion and cook and stir until meat is brown.
- Stir in chili powder and salt, cooking another 1 minute.
- Stir in tomatoes AND their liquid, adding next the beans and corn.
- Cook all together over high heat until bubbling.
- Reduce heat to low, cover and simmer for just 10 minutes.
- Prepare the potatoes according to the package for 4 servings.
- Stir cheddar cheese and cilantro into the potatoes.
- Top the meat with ¼ Cup of potatoes for each serving.

BEEF STEW IN UNDER 30 MINUTES
Ingredients
- 1 TBSP olive oil
- 1 lb. boneless beef sirloin steak, ¾" thick, cut into 1" cubes. Or use ground beef.
- 1 can Condensed Tomato Soup
- 1 can Condensed French Onion Soup
- 1 TBSP. Worcestershire sauce
- 24 oz. frozen vegetables for stew, thawed and drained
Instructions
- Heat the olive oil in a skillet and add beef and cook until browned and juices evaporate, stirring constantly. For ground beef, stir but leave in larger chunks than for tacos.
- Pour in the soups, Worcestershire, and vegetables and heat to the boil.
- Cover, reduce heat to low and cook 10 minutes.
MEXICAN INSPIRED BAKED POTATOES
Ingredients
- 1 lb. ground beef
- 1 can Cheddar Cheese Soup
- 1 Cup Chunky Salsa
- 4 hot baked potatoes, split open lengthwise [fast cooking in the microwave]
- Low fat sour cream or yogurt
- Sliced pitted ripe olives
Instructions
- Brown beef in skillet.
- Combine with soup and salsa and heat through.
- Serve over potatoes and top with sour cream and olives.
LASAGNA SOUP
Ingredients
- 1 lb. ground beef
- ¼ tsp. garlic powder
- 28 oz. beef broth
- 14½ oz. diced tomatoes
- ¼ tsp. dried Italian seasoning
- 1½ Cups uncooked corkscrew pasta
- ¼ Cup grated Parmesan cheese
Instructions
- Cook beef with garlic in skillet until browned.
- Add the broth, tomatoes and Italian seasoning and heat to boiling.
- Stir in pasta and cook over medium heat 10 min. or until pasta is al dente.
- Stir in cheese and serve with more cheese as a topping, if desired.
SPEEDY ASIAN BEEF
Ingredients
- 1 large New York Strip steak (300g)
- 2 cloves chopped garlic
- 3 TBSP chopped shallots or green onions
- 3 - 5 hot chili peppers
- 3 sliced red shallots (or red onion if you cannot find red shallots)
- Juice of 2 limes
- Small bunch mint leaves
- Small bunch coriander or cilantro leaves
- ½ TBSP sugar
- Fish Sauce
Instructions
- Trim any excess fat from the steak and cook or grill it to medium rare. Do not over cook.
- Add all dry ingredients together and add juice from 1 lime and about a TBSP of fish sauce.
- Taste. Add sugar, fish sauce, or lime juice, if needed
- When steak is somewhat cool, cut into thin slices and add it with coriander and mint to the salad.
- Toss and serve.
NIMBLE PIZZA LOAVES
Serves 6 and can be made ahead and reheated within 3 days.
Ingredients
- 26 oz. Italian Pasta Sauce
- 1 1/4 lb. ground beef or turkey
- 1 1/4 Cups Pepperidge Farm® Herb Seasoned Stuffing
- 2 whole beaten eggs
- 1 medium onion, chopped
- ¼ Cup chopped green bell pepper
- 1 tsp oregano
- 4 oz. Mozzarella cheese, cut into 6 pieces - one for the center of each loaf
Instructions
- Pre Heat oven to 400 Degrees F.
- Combine ¾ Cup pasta sauce, beef, stuffing, eggs, onion, pepper and oregano and mix well. Shape into 6 loaves, placing 1 piece of cheese in the center of each loaf first.
- Place loaves into a large enough baking pan to hold them without crowding.
- Bake the loaves at 400 Degrees F for 25 min. or until done. Serve
